OUR CABIN SITS ON THE BANK OF THE S. FORK OF THE TYE RIVER (aka SKYKOMISH RIVER S. FORK) WITH A SWEEPING NATURAL VIEW ACROSS THE RIVER CHANNEL OF 5,000' BECKLER PEAK AND THE WILD SKY WILDERNESS in Mt. Baker-Snoqualmie National Forest. Nearby activities include hiking, biking, rafting & kayaking, rock climbing, birdwatching, mushrooming, exploring the lakes and waterfalls and historic areas around Stevens Pass, historic Skykomish and Index, or just relaxing to the sound of the river or a crackling fire.
THIS CABIN IS CUTE AND PERFECT FOR 1-3 COUPLES OR A FAMILY TO GET AWAY FROM IT ALL! The living area is bright and cheery, with lots of windows looking across the river to the mountain wilderness beyond. The hardwood floors and wood paneling give the place a rustic feel, and you'll love curling up in front of the fire on our comfy leather furniture for conversation, a glass of wine, or a good book or a movie. The living room opens to a deck on the river bank with a table and six chairs and a gas BBQ to facilitate outdoor meals or projects. The dining area views the greenery and the river by day or a roaring fire at night, and is perfect for after-dinner games or even doing a little work using our high-speed internet access & wifi. The fully equipped kitchen is newly updated to feature modern appliances and a beautiful granite countertop so that guests can visit while the chef prepares the feast.
The three bedrooms each feature a queen-size bed, reading lamp(s) and a dresser and/or closet for storage, and a couple of airbeds can be arranged for children to sleep in their parents room if desired. The main bathroom downstairs has a double sink separated from the toilet & shower, with beautiful stone tile and a luxurious heated floor throughout. Another half-bath and toilet are upstairs. The mudroom is perfect for washing and/or drying wet or muddy clothing after a day out-of-doors, and includes a full washer-dryer.
Enjoy a BBQ on the deck or an evening campfire under the stars, listening to the river.
Wildlife lovers will enjoy an ever-changing 'show' starring the occasional Bald Eagle or Osprey, wild ducks (harlequins, mergansers and wood ducks), water ouzels, swallows, swifts, nighthawks, etc., and laugh as the Rufous Hummingbirds joust for territory and mates. Squirrels, chipmunks, and racoons live on the property and at various times Black Bears, Coyotes, Otters, Mink, Beaver and Deer have visited, and we regularly observe coho salmon spawn in the channel in front of our cabin. Early spring is especially nice if you like hummingbirds, frog choruses, and native wildflowers.
